|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Water Softening System Install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Whole House Filtration System |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Ultraviolet Water Purification |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Reverse Osmosis System | $4,000 - $12,000 |
| Water Testing and Analysis | $300 - $800 |
| Tank Replacement or Repair | $1,500 - $4,500 |
Factors Influencing Cost
Water treatment services in Saint Clair Shores, MI, encompass a range of solutions to improve water quality for residential and commercial properties. Understanding typical project components can help property owners assess scope and costs associated with water treatment upgrades or installations.
- Materials: Includes options such as carbon filters, reverse osmosis membranes, and softening systems, with material choices depending on water quality and treatment goals.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from small point-of-use units for single fixtures to whole-house systems designed for larger properties or commercial facilities.
- Labor Complexity: Varies based on system type, existing plumbing configurations, and installation requirements, influencing overall project duration and effort.
- Permitting: May involve local regulations or permits for larger or specialized systems, especially those connected to municipal water supplies or requiring plumbing modifications.
- Extras: Additional components such as water softeners, UV sterilizers, or maintenance accessories can be included to enhance system functionality or longevity.
